Recognizing Signs That Your Septic System Needs Attention
Indicators of a Failing Septic System
Being vigilant approximately your septic approach can save you from steeply-priced repairs down the road. Here are a few warning indications:
1. Foul Odors
If there are unfamiliar smells coming from your backyard or drain fields, it might imply a main issue with the tank.
2. Slow Drains
Slow draining sinks or toilets may just imply that your septic tank is full and demands pumping.
three. Pooling Water
Excess water round the drain subject suggests that wastewater seriously is not being absorbed well.
four. Lush Grass
An unusually green patch in your yard may mean that effluent is leaking out in which it won't.

Understanding The Costs Involved in Septic Pumping
Average Costs for Septic Services
While expenditures vary via location and designated services required, the following’s a popular breakdown:
| Service Type | Cost Range | |--------------|------------| | Initial Inspection | $100 - $300 | | Standard Pumping | $250 - $500 | | Repairs | $500 - $five,000 |
Factors Affecting Pricing
Several points can result quotes:
- Geographic location Size of the tank Accessibility issues (e.g., not easy-to-succeed in areas)
